Senior Embedded Software Engineer, DevOps

1 week ago


Singapore Rockwell Automation Full time

As a Senior DevOps Engineer in Rockwell Automation, you will become a member of the team responsible for supporting the internal development teams in adopting the Enterprise DevOps Platform as well as maintaining the software recommended by Product Security team.

This position will work with other stakeholders within region and globally.

**Responsibilities**:

- Automate builds and develop and integrate tools to support Continuous Integration and Continuous Delivery (CI/CD) and reporting across projects.
- Develop and maintain well-architected build scripts to automate builds.
- Coordinate effort among multiple sites and other DevOps personnel.
- Liaison with IT to comply with infrastructure, corporate policies, and the Secure Development Environment.
- Monitor and maintain build environment and software releases for various product branches on a daily, weekly, and scheduled basis.
- Install support to package entire software or at component level for deployment. Design develops and test integration of different components and systems using APIs and scripting to test features that span across multiple systems.
- Networks with senior internal/external personnel in own area of expertise as well as networks with key contacts outside own area of expertise.
- Normally receives general instructions on routine work, detailed instructions on new projects or assignments. Open to receiving and sharing of new ideas.
- Functions effectively in a globally distributed team environment as both an individual contributor and a leader.

**Qualifications**:Education, Desired Skills and Experience**
- Bachelor of Science in Computer Science, Computer/Electronics Engineering, or a related field.
- Possess a minimum of five years’ hands-on experience in setting up and deploying a CI/CD environment with hands-on software development and configuration management experience required.
- Knowledge of CI/CD related tools like Jenkins, GitLab CI, Artifactory or similar
- Knowledge of infrastructure and configuration management tools such as Terraform, Ansible or similar
- At least one general-purpose or scripting language (Python, Bash or other)
- Knowledge of container technologies like Docker, Kubernetes, Helm.
- Exposure to on-prem or public clouds, ideally VMware and Azure
- Understanding of IT networking, firewall rules, domain administration, common network protocols and services
- Experience using modern source control management system like Git
- Experience in setting up and managing software development server hardware and software, specifically on Microsoft Windows and Linux.
- Strong collaborator in a matrixed organization. Proven ability to work effectively as a member of a team or independently required.
- Proven ability to communicate technical information of a complex nature clearly and concisely in verbal and written form required.
- Good analytical and troubleshooting skills
- Ability to work in teams or independently and action-oriented



  • Singapore Sioux High Tech Software Ltd. Full time

    **About Sioux** Sioux is a strategic **high-tech solutions provider** that develops, innovates and assembles complex high-tech systems We have a team of over 1,200 dedicated engineers who either support our clients or serve as their Research and Development department. Our strong productivity allows us to speed up product development, giving our clients a...


  • Singapore SGInnovate Full time

    Embedded Software Engineer (1-year traineeship programme) Embedded Software Engineer (1-year traineeship programme) Get AI-powered advice on this job and more exclusive features. Direct message the job poster from SGInnovate Ecosystem and Community Builder | SGInnovate Talent (PowerX) About Us Vivo Surgical is a patient-focused, clinician-driven medical...


  • Singapore Rockwell Automation Full time

    Job Description As a Senior DevOps Engineer in Rockwell Automation, you will become a member of the team responsible for supporting the internal development teams in adopting the Enterprise DevOps Platform as well as maintaining the software recommended by Product Security team. This position will work with other stakeholders within region and...


  • Singapore Espressif Systems Full time

    Design and develop wireless protocol stacks such as Wi-Fi, Bluetooth, 15.4, and ensure coexistence among them Develop multimedia algorithms including H264, JPEG, and audio codecs; work on multimedia protocols like DNA and VoIP; and contribute to other components in the multimedia SDK Design and implement embedded multimedia solutions based on...

  • DevOps Engineer

    4 days ago


    Singapore The Software Practice Pte Ltd Full time

    2 days ago Be among the first 25 applicants We're a Singapore based software consulting firm looking for smart people. You should be able to learn quickly and work independently - we'll help you as best as we can, but you must be tenacious and resourceful enough to figure out things you don't know how to do. You'll be in charge of all deployment related...


  • Singapore ENVIRODYNAMICS SOLUTIONS PTE. LTD. Full time

    **Job Advertisement: Embedded Software Engineer - Embedded ML Systems** Are you ready to revolutionize the world of semiconductor technology? Our esteemed client, a semiconductor company, is seeking a talented Embedded Software Engineer with a passion for cutting-edge Machine Learning (ML) systems. **Position**:Embedded Software Engineer - Embedded ML...

  • Software Engineer

    15 hours ago


    Singapore NodeFlair Full time

    **Job Summary**: **Salary** S$4,694 - S$7,292 / Monthly EST **Job Type** Permanent **Seniority** Mid Junior **Years of Experience** 2-5 years **Tech Stacks** Java C - As a Software Engineer in Thales Embedded Product Development Team in ECC, you will participate in the design, implementation, validation and deployment of Embedded Products for major OEM...

  • Software Engineer

    2 days ago


    Singapore NodeFlair Full time

    **Job Summary**: **Job Type** Permanent **Seniority** **Years of Experience** Information not provided **Tech Stacks** Java C **A week in the life of an Embedded Software Engineer**: - Participate to the development of next generation operating systems for future devices. - Being in agile development environment to work closely within team and multiple...


  • Singapore G. TECH PTE. LTD. Full time

    Responsibilities: ● Design, develop, and maintain embedded software for embedded platforms and bare-metal systems. ● Implement and optimize communication protocols (e.g., Serial, CAN, Ethernet) to interface with hardware components. ● Collaborate closely with hardware engineers and system architects to ensure seamless hardware-software integration and...


  • Singapore RGF Full time

    **Location**: Singapore **Salary**: Open **Industry**: Manufacturing, Engineering & Industrial **Sub-industry**: Industrial Manufacturing **Function**: Manufacturing & Engineering **Job Description**: **Our Client**: RGF represents a leading provider of semiconductor and electronics assembly solutions serving the global automotive, consumer,...